ultimatums to make a woman mad
choose between nothing, and half of what you had
there's nothing harder than unrequited love
sends you screaming and howling for the angels above

and it gets easier, the longer time fades
it gets harder every time you turn a new page
and when it's over, when they no longer want you by their side
all you have is your breath, and the dull ache in your mind

you're waiting for a response
while i'm trying to read between the lines of your songs
to see if maybe there's a way
to get you to come back, and stay.

ice falls from the clouds
and all i can hear is the sound
of it falling to the ground
ticking like a clock, so ******* loud.

this is an ultimatum,
i remember the train station
your hands, their creations
i recite you word by word, verbatim
